Learn how to choose the most suitable bank for your manufacturing business!

Running a manufacturing business can be daunting and difficult. With all the challenges of finding suppliers, managing production, and growing your customer base, you may find yourself feeling overwhelmed. 

One aspect that is often overlooked in this process is choosing the right bank to support your manufacturing business. Finding the right financial partner can make all the difference when it comes to ensuring the success of your venture.

 

Before you choose a banking partner, it’s important to consider what type of services you need and how much flexibility you require.

 For example, many manufacturers require access to short-term financing solutions such as working capital loans or asset-based lines of credit in order to keep operations running smoothly. These types of services are typically provided by commercial banks. Alternatively, if you need more specialized services such as export finance or import/export letters of credit, then an export finance bank might be a better fit for your company.

 

In addition to considering the types of services offered, you also need to compare fees and rates. Different banks may offer a variety of products at different prices, so it’s important to shop around and find the best deal for your business. Lastly, think about how accessible your banker is and how responsive they are when you have questions or concerns. Having a proactive bank partner that understands your company’s needs can make a world of difference in the success of your manufacturing business.

 

With all these factors in mind, finding the right banking partner should be an informed decision based on research and comparison shopping.

In addition to understanding which type of financing solutions will best suit your needs, there are other factors that should be considered when choosing a banking partner. 

One important factor is convenience; depending on where your manufacturing facilities are located, you may want to look for a bank that has local branches and knowledgeable bankers who understand the nuances of doing business in that region.

 

Another factor to consider when selecting a banking partner is technology capabilities – specifically how up-to-date their systems are and whether they offer mobile banking apps or other software platforms designed for manufacturers. This can help streamline processes such as payments, payroll processing, and accounts receivables management by enabling real time communication between your team and their financial advisors.

 

Finally, you should also think about potential costs associated with using different banks’ products and services – for instance fees for wire transfers or foreign exchange transactions may vary from one bank to another so it’s important to do some research before committing to one provider over another.

 

By taking these considerations into account before selecting a banking partner for your manufacturing business, you can ensure that you have chosen a solution that meets all of your current needs while also providing enough flexibility so that the relationship can grow with your company as it evolves over time. With the right financial partner at your side, you can focus on growing your business without having to worry about missing out on any opportunities due to lack of access to timely capital or inefficient processes related to payments or cash flow management.
